About this calculator This calculator converts cooling capacity between BTU per hour and refrigeration tons, using the standard relationship of 12,000 BTU/hr per ton. Use it when comparing equipment ratings across manufacturers that may express capacity in different units, or when converting between specifications and load calculations.

What is a ton of refrigeration?

A ton of refrigeration is a unit of cooling capacity equal to 12,000 BTU per hour. The term originates from the amount of heat required to melt one short ton (2,000 pounds) of ice at 32°F in 24 hours: 2,000 lb multiplied by the latent heat of fusion of ice (144 BTU/lb) divided by 24 hours equals 12,000 BTU/hr. In commercial HVAC, cooling equipment capacity is commonly expressed in tons for larger systems and BTU/hr for smaller equipment. Residential air conditioners typically range from 1.5 to 5 tons (18,000 to 60,000 BTU/hr), while commercial rooftop units range from 3 to 150 tons. Manufacturers may list capacity in either unit depending on the product line, so conversion between the two is a routine step in equipment selection and load calculation review.
